A offer by AC Milan for Chelsea center-back Benoit Badiashile was rejected, and rumors have it that another Blues defender will take his place at the end of the season.

Badiashile, 22, was acquired from Monaco during the most recent January transfer window for a fee of £32.7 million. With a reputation as one of France’s most promising central defenders, Badiashile quickly established himself in Chelsea’s starting lineup during the second half of the 2022–2023 season.

However, injuries have disrupted Badiashile’s time this term, limiting the Frenchman to just three appearances across all competitions.

What’s more, the summer arrival of Axel Disasi as well as Levi Colwill being integrated into the first-team have caused a logjam at centre-half.

The ageless Thiago Silva remains an automatic pick, while Wesley Fofana will fancy his chances of breaking into the team when fully recovered from knee surgery.

As such, competition for places at the heart of defence is fierce, something that has seen Colwill utilised primarily at left-back thus far.

Badiashile got the nod in Chelsea’s last two Premier League matches, though endured a torrid outing in the 4-1 defeat to Newcastle one week ago.

Indeed, TuttoMercato reported Milan were prepared to offer Badiashile a way out via a loan with an option to a buy. Any such offer would be made with regards to a move in next month’s January window.

Milan and Chelsea have a strong working relationship in the transfer market having overseen a plethora of deals between the pair in recent years.

Tiemoue Bakayoko, Olivier Giroud, Fikayo Tomori, Ruben Loftus-Cheek and Christian Pulisic have all joined The Rossoneri from Chelsea.

Now, a fresh update from TuttoMercatoWeb claims Milan have acted on their interest in Badiashile and lodged a loan bid with an option to buy.

Chelsea is said to have rejected the suggestion, though. Two explanations were given for this.

First off, after less than 20 appearances for the team, Chelsea allegedly feels it’s far too soon to pass judgment on the Frenchman.

Secondly, The Blues don’t want to add more challenge for themselves, and sending Badiashile on would entail signing a replacement player.
